Friday, September 18 -- Day 2


We awoke to a humid, muggy day. After breakfast, we visited the Presbyterian school where Tracy teaches. Apparently, when one of the teachers learned that we were back, she wanted us to come and tell the Turtle of Koka story to her five-year-olds. We shared that story with about 100 first years and then went to visit the third years who heard the story of the Donkey in the Well. Tracy surprised David by asking him to tell the children what he used to do -- which is, of course, fly airplanes for the U.S. military. That perked the children, especially the boys, right up.
Shortly after we returned to the Sandassies' home, it started raining. This has been the type of rain that cools things off a bit. We'll be having lunch soon -- curried goat and rice. Then off to church tonight for an evening service. I'll have the privilege of bringing the message of the Lord, so I suppose I should sign off and get ready.
